Outdated or multi-byte data types often pose a significant obstacle in legacy data migration projects. Many general-purpose data conversion tools reach their limits when specific, single-byte character sets – deeply embedded in core systems – need to be processed.
If a migration solution cannot natively distinguish and correctly convert complex character sets such as LATIN2, Cyrillic or Arabic – or, for example, cannot process ASCII data in EBCDIC sequences – ‘unsupported’ errors and opaque system states quickly arise. In practice, this often means that individual scripts must be developed and maintained for each data type.
